The Pharmaceutical Research and Manufacturers of America (PhRMA) announced today that it is partnering with the National Minority Quality Forum (NMQF) and Microsoft to help increase diversity in clinical trials.
“Promoting awareness and creating connectivity that can translate into enhanced participation in clinical trials by a diverse patient population is a priority for PhRMA and our member companies,” stated Dr. Salvatore Alesci, M.D., Ph.D, Vice President of Scientific Affairs at PhRMA. “This collaboration brings clinical research and healthcare closer to each other to prevent disparities in the evaluation and access to innovative medicines.”
The collaboration will include joint outreach efforts as well as support for the creation of the National Clinical Trial Network (NCTN), an interactive portal linking communities of patients, practicing physicians and researchers to increase participation and diversity in clinical trials, which will be introduced in the fourth quarter of 2013.
